#01e899 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01e899 is composed of 0.4% red, 91%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 159.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#01e899 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00d133.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#01e899 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01e899 has RGB values of R:1, G:232, B:153 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 125081.

Shades and Tints of #01e899
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00110b is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#01e899
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7c77 is the less saturated color, while #01e899 is the most saturated one.
